Output 51e3a7af10c19026595e2d73d8673aa393a7cb9dc1fb3a3cf0a08bd30f443321:29
- value
- 625749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ee05f577be39092eae6ba04b498f19b56bb3f677 OP_EQUAL
- address
- 3PPZtEBh4xcbFQ1aupQfBmePCFRtvdqEhy
- transaction
- 51e3a7af10c19026595e2d73d8673aa393a7cb9dc1fb3a3cf0a08bd30f443321
- confirmations
- 225598
- spent
- true